在计算机网络系统中,端口映射和端口转发是非常重要的功能。有时候我们需要将多个端口的数据流量镜像到一个端口,以便进行数据分析和监测。本文将从多个角度分析如何实现多个端口的镜像到一个端口的功能。
一、为什么需要将多个端口镜像到一个端口?
在计算机网络系统中,端口是用于通信的虚拟通道。我们通常使用不同的端口进行不同的应用程序或服务的访问。当面临多个端口数据流量的监测和分析的时候,如果一个一个地去监测或分析,这将会是一项非常艰难和费时的工作。因此,需要将多个端口的数据流量镜像到一个端口中,以便于更加高效的进行数据分析和监测。
二、如何实现多个端口镜像到一个端口?
实现将多个端口数据流量镜像到一个端口需要通过一些功能强大的网络设备来完成。下面我们将介绍两种实现多个端口镜像到一个端口的方法。
1.使用交换机实现
交换机是计算机网络中常用的重要设备。交换机在本质上是一个多端口的网络连接设备,它可以将入口数据帧中的源地址和目的地址用于建立端口间的映射和转发。因此,利用交换机实现多个端口镜像到一个端口的方法是非常直观和有效的。
实现这种方法需要使用支持镜像功能的交换机,具体操作如下:
(1)在交换机上创建一个虚拟端口用于接收镜像流量。
(2)通过交换机的端口镜像功能将需要镜像的端口数据流量镜像到该虚拟端口中。
(3)在虚拟端口上使用数据包抓取工具或网络监控工具,对数据流量进行分析和监控。
2.使用路由器实现
路由器是计算机网络中用于连接不同网络之间的重要设备。利用路由器实现将多个端口镜像到一个端口的方法是一种非常简单而直观的方法。
下面是具体的操作步骤:
(1)在路由器上创建一个inet端口(类似于一个虚拟网卡)。
(2)对所有需要镜像的端口设置流量镜像功能,并将所有镜像流量发送到创建的inet端口。
(3)在inet端口上配置IP地址及子网掩码,并使用数据包抓取工具或网络监控工具,对数据流量进行分析和监控。
三、应用场景
多个端口镜像到一个端口功能可以被广泛应用于各种场景中,下面我们将介绍一些常见的应用场景。
1. 网络故障分析
当网络出现故障的时候,我们需要对多个端口上的数据流量进行分析来查找问题所在。利用将多个端口镜像到一个端口的功能,可以更加高效的进行故障排查。
2. 网络安全监控
在当前的信息时代中,网络安全问题已经成为一个非常重要的问题。将多个端口镜像到一个端口中,可以将所有的流量数据集中到一个位置,进行更加全面和深入的网络安全审计和监控。
3. 应用性能监控
对于某些特定的应用场景,可能需要对多个端口的数据流量进行实时监测来得知该应用的性能状况。将多个端口镜像到一个端口中,可以通过数据流量监控工具得到应用的实时性能数据,方便进行性能分析和调整。
扫码咨询 领取资料